Regional pest professionals normally utilize two primary methods when installing a Termite Barrier Canberra system: chemical soil applications and physical barriers. A chemical soil barrier is developed by digging a trench around the entire edge of the concrete piece or interior piers, using a specialized non‑repellent termiticide to the excavated soil, and after that filling up the trench. Contemporary termiticides do not simply repel termites; instead, foraging pests unconsciously traverse the treated ground, ingest the chemical, and spread it throughout the colony by means of their grooming habits, eventually getting rid of the whole population.
When building brand-new buildings or carrying out read more big additions, installers normally prefer a physical Termite Barrier Canberra system. This technique embeds robust, chemically‑treated collars and thick sheet membranes into the concrete slab and pipeline openings throughout the initial framing phase. Instead of eliminating termites, these physical barriers press them toward the surface area, where their mud tunnels become visible throughout regular visual inspections, avoiding them from reaching the main roofing system or floor joists.
The longevity and effectiveness of a Termite Barrier Canberra installation depend greatly on the surrounding landscaping routines of the homeowner. For example, producing garden beds straight versus the external brickwork or enabling thick natural mulch to rise above the damp evidence course can quickly bridge the treated zone, providing termites a clear, uncontaminated pathway directly into the home. Likewise, storing stacks of firewood, wood offcuts, or old cardboard boxes against the side of a dwelling provides both a food source and a sheltered environment that invites undesirable pest activity.
Efficient water management is likewise necessary for local property owners to maintain the efficiency of their preventive measures. Since termites are drawn in to wet conditions, leaking hot‑water overflow valves, malfunctioning garden taps, and broken downspouts can produce localized wet areas that damage or nullify chemical soil treatments. Making certain that surface water drains pipes immediately away from your home's foundation and keeping weep holes completely free of soil or debris will significantly decrease the opportunity of a breach.
